Question research1: How do parents actively influence children's eating habits?

  • Parents are the first teacher to children. Children learn many things from their parents because they are the closest people in the world. Parents play an essential role in shaping their living habits. "New research suggests that the food preferences of young children could be related to their risk of having obesity later in life. Parents and caregivers can influence young children's food preferences" (Parental Influence On Children's Eating Habits,2012). Parents' eating habits can affect children's health directly or indirectly. We want to know how parents actively influence their children's eating habits, and how do those habits relate to children's health
